Key Insights

  • Nick Woltemade is expected to start against Portugal in the Nations League semi-final.
  • He impressed Julian Nagelsmann during training, showcasing his technical skills and goal-scoring ability.
  • Woltemade had a successful season with VfB Stuttgart, scoring 17 goals in 33 appearances.
  • After the Nations League, Woltemade will join the German U21 team for the European Championship.

In-Depth Analysis

Nick Woltemade's rise to the national team is a testament to his hard work and dedication. After a stellar season with VfB Stuttgart, where he demonstrated his versatility and scoring ability, Julian Nagelsmann has taken notice. Woltemade's height (1.98m) gives him an advantage in aerial duels, and his technical skills make him a threat in the box.

His debut comes at a crucial time for Germany, as they aim to win their first title since the 2017 Confed-Cup victory. Nagelsmann's decision to potentially start both Woltemade and Niclas Füllkrug indicates a desire to utilize different striker types to exploit Portugal's weaknesses.

Following the Nations League, Woltemade will immediately join the U21 squad for the European Championship, showcasing his importance to Germany's national setup across different age groups.
